Find the surface area (in cm) of a cube with one of its side as 6 cm.

A

296

B

286

C

36

D

216

The correct Answer is:
To find the surface area of a cube with a side length of 6 cm, we can follow these steps: ### Step-by-Step Solution: 1. **Identify the formula for the surface area of a cube**: The surface area (SA) of a cube can be calculated using the formula: \[ SA = 6A^2 \] where \( A \) is the length of one side of the cube. 2. **Substitute the given side length into the formula**: Here, the side length \( A \) is given as 6 cm. We will substitute this value into the formula: \[ SA = 6 \times (6 \, \text{cm})^2 \] 3. **Calculate \( (6 \, \text{cm})^2 \)**: First, we need to calculate \( 6^2 \): \[ (6 \, \text{cm})^2 = 36 \, \text{cm}^2 \] 4. **Multiply by 6**: Now, we multiply this result by 6: \[ SA = 6 \times 36 \, \text{cm}^2 \] \[ SA = 216 \, \text{cm}^2 \] 5. **Final Result**: Therefore, the surface area of the cube is: \[ \text{Surface Area} = 216 \, \text{cm}^2 \]
